Job Description

The Director of Program, Partnership and Clinical Management is responsible for leading a global team composed of two groups: Program and Partnership Managers, and Clinical Systems Managers.

 

The Program and Partnership Managers lead cross-functional teams across Engineering, Quality, Supply Chain, Marketing, Operations, Human Factors, Project Management, and external partners to execute a portfolio of projects focused on delivery system constituent parts of combination products.

 

The Clinical Systems Managers lead cross-functional teams in defining strategy and executing the implementation of devices, including combination products and aesthetics devices, into AbbVie clinical programs. This includes devices, primary packaging, accessories, secondary packaging, instructions for use, and labeling.

 

The Director ensures that strategies and plans for assigned programs align with patient and customer needs as well as the business objectives of the PPDST and Asset teams. The Director reports to the Vice President of Device and Combination Products Development.

Management of External Partners:

The Director ensures that Program Managers effectively manage relationships and performance with key external device development partners. A strong and efficient partner governance process should be defined and implemented, including key interface definition, meeting cadence, schedule performance monitoring, project scope and change control, issue escalation, and financial tracking.

 

Program risks must be identified and mitigated throughout the partner lifecycle. The Director also ensures timely and effective communication of partner performance to the broader AbbVie organization, as needed. In addition, the Director works with the AbbVie contracts team and external partners to define and track performance against the Statement of Work. The Director is responsible for providing accurate and timely cost estimates to support budgeting and forecasting.

 

Functional Management:

The Director directly manages a global group of Project Managers through effective delegation of responsibilities, support for professional development, and timely, actionable performance feedback. This role also emphasizes continuous improvement in the team’s project and program management capabilities, as well as product development-related processes.

 

Impact on AbbVie:

This role has broad influence on the development and launch of AbbVie assets when a device or combination product delivery system is required. These systems are often technically complex, involve multiple subsystems, interface directly with the patient, and must meet global requirements. External partner management is typically required.

 

The Director must represent the R&D function to cross-functional leadership through effective communication, strong influence, and sound judgment.
